How is the prevention of money laundering addressed in the technology sector and high-tech companies in Mexico, where transactions can be highly digital?
In the technology sector and high-tech companies, specific regulations apply to prevent money laundering, including the identification of users and the notification of significant transactions. Mexico promotes the use of advanced technologies for the detection of suspicious activities.

What is the importance of background checks when hiring personnel for renewable energy projects in Peru?
When contracting for renewable energy projects in Peru, background checks are essential to ensure the technical and ethical suitability of the professionals involved. Experience in similar projects, specific certifications for renewable energies, and the ability to comply with environmental and safety standards in the sector are evaluated.
What happens if the tenant does not pay the rent in Mexico?
If the tenant does not pay the rent, the landlord can initiate eviction proceedings to recover the property and demand payment of back rent.

What is the situation of the rights of women at work in the hotel and hospitality sector in Mexico?
Women working in the hotel and hospitality sector in Mexico face specific challenges in exercising their labor rights. Measures have been implemented to promote their protection and well-being, such as the promotion of safe and healthy working conditions, access to training and development opportunities, and the prevention of harassment and discrimination in the work environment.
